На этом уроке мы подкорректируем модель User и реализуем аутентификацию на сайте через базу данных
Дата отправки отчёта:
21 декабря 2019 г.
Задание выполнено: за
3 час. 36 мин.
Чему научился:
генератор ActiveRecord не пускал ругаясь на наличие пароля у пользователя root - первый заслон Это преодолел, поменяв пароль этого пользователя в phpMyAdmin на отсутствующий, и о чудо, в генератор http://localhost:8888/gii/model зайти и создать новую модель удалось Но после этого phpMyAdmin остался недоволен моими правками пароля пользователя root и ждет решения. в config.inc.php замена $cfg['Servers'][$i]['password'] = 'root'; на $cfg['Servers'][$i]['password'] = ''; войти в админку phpMyAdmin не помогла, пишет в ответ MySQL said:Documentation Cannot connect: invalid settings. Но вход в phpMyAdmin - проблема частная, не думаю, что не удастся забороть )
Про шифрование md5 слышал давно, встречал в сетевых подключениях в настройках, но особо не углублялся и не интересовался, что это за фича такая. Спасибо Валерию за рассказ о сути этого метода и показ на пальцах с примерами что там за что отвечает и зачем вообще все это нужно. Имея общее представление можно копать вглубь.
Надо было с консоли ресетнуть пароль mysqladmin -u root -password 'newpassword', а потом прописать его в config.inc.php, но хотя он там и так пропишется...
Отчёт оценивали: 791. Валерий Жданов+12146. Иван+123855. Андрей Межлумов022955. Vladimir+1162. Андрей+19014. Николай Денисов+122133. ES35+113417. Chip+118842. Степан+1
Начинаем практику по языку C#
Чтобы стать хорошим программистом — нужно писать программы.
На нашем сайте очень много практических упражнений.
После заполнения формы ты будешь подписан на рассылку
«C# Вебинары и Видеоуроки»,
у тебя появится доступ к видеоурокам и консольным задачам.
Несколько раз в неделю тебе будут приходить письма —
приглашения на вебинары, информация об акциях и скидках,
полезная информация по C#.
Научился: Всему потихоньку учимся, для меня здесь все в новинку, трудновато все запомнить Трудности: Никак не мог залогиниться, долго искал причину, а оказывается пропустил в одной строчке кода символ доллара